Default How do I change one point in a scatter chart color

Hi,

The easiest way is to add another series to plot just the points that
need a different colour.

Assuming your data example is in the range A1:D5 then add this formula
to E2 and drag down to E5.

=IF(D2<1,C2,NA())

Now add the series E2:E5 to the chart and format the series as required.
